Cremona's table of elliptic curves

Curve 1770b1

1770 = 2 · 3 · 5 · 59



Data for elliptic curve 1770b1

Field Data Notes
Atkin-Lehner 2+ 3- 5+ 59- Signs for the Atkin-Lehner involutions
Class 1770b Isogeny class
Conductor 1770 Conductor
∏ cp 10 Product of Tamagawa factors cp
deg 240 Modular degree for the optimal curve
Δ -286740 = -1 · 22 · 35 · 5 · 59 Discriminant
Eigenvalues 2+ 3- 5+  1 -2  3 -5 -6 Hecke eigenvalues for primes up to 20
Equation [1,0,1,16,2] [a1,a2,a3,a4,a6]
Generators [3:7:1] Generators of the group modulo torsion
j 494913671/286740 j-invariant
L 2.4843094382809 L(r)(E,1)/r!
Ω 1.8485570175623 Real period
R 0.13439182100842 Regulator
r 1 Rank of the group of rational points
S 1 (Analytic) order of Ш
t 1 Number of elements in the torsion subgroup
Twists 14160l1 56640i1 5310o1 8850v1 Quadratic twists by: -4 8 -3 5
